Myostatin (MSTN) is a perfectly-claimed unfavorable regulator of muscle mass progress and also a member of The reworking growth factor (TGF) spouse and children. MSTN has critical features in skeletal muscle mass (SM), and its crucial involvement in several Conditions has produced it a crucial therapeutic focus on. Various procedures dependant on the use of pure compounds to inhibitory peptides are getting used to inhibit the action of MSTN.

MYO-029 is recombinant human myostatin-particular antibody that did not present a big enhancement in muscle mass strength and function in Grownup muscular dystrophies [44]. The other compound developed by Amgen, AMG 745, has an unknown composition, but its screening was stopped after stage I scientific trials [102]. The situation of employing antimyostatin compounds is probably going resulting from the flexibility of your ActRIIB to bind other ligands in the TGF-β spouse and children resulting in a redundancy of myostatin.

Myostatin signaling and inhibition: myostatin circulates as a complex of two C-terminal dimers and two N-terminal inhibitory prodomains. In the event the prodomains are proteolytically cleaved, the Lively myostatin dimer can bind to its receptor ActRIIB, which recruits Alk4/5. Phosphorylated and activated Alk4/five in turn leads to phosphorylation of Smad2/three, which recruits Smad4.

The establishment of myostatin as a sturdy adverse regulator of muscle and bone mass has specified myostatin as a beautiful therapeutic concentrate on for different musculoskeletal Problems. In actual fact, several myostatin-inhibiting pharmacological brokers have already been developed, and plenty of of them have progressed to human trials and they are at this time beneath evaluation (Desk one). What needs to be thought of is The reality that most myostatin inhibitors also block the activity of other closely-similar myostatin inhibitor drugs users of your TGF-β relatives [9-12], raising the potential of undesired Unwanted effects. In this regard, our group has just lately shown that overexpression of follistatin (FST), an endogenous antagonist of myostatin, boosts skeletal muscle mass mass by suppressing the exercise of myostatin, but diminishes BMD and induces bone fractures probably by means of binding and repressing the action of GDF11, a myostatin paralog that promotes osteogenesis in distinction to myostatin, emphasizing which the opposing roles of myostatin and GDF11 has to be very carefully thought of when creating myostatin inhibitors for therapeutic intervention [six].
